Network NOVA with Katherine White
(Aug 15, 2022) Catherine Read talks with Katherine White, one of the founders of Network NOVA. This organization came together in 2017 following the Women’s March in Washington, DC. In only 70 days following that event, they launched the first Women’s Summit in June of 2017.
They have hosted a Women’s Summit every year since then, including a multi-day virtual event during 2020.
This year, there are three events – one in June in Northern Virginia, an event in Waynesboro called Rural Valley in August, and the third summit in Virginia Beach in September. Attendance has grown exponentially every year since its inception. Women have attended these events from all over Virginia every year, and the number of elected progressive women candidates also continues to rise. There is a correlation here. Network NOVA continues to connect women with candidate training, workshops, and networks of supporters and donors. That network gets bigger and stronger every year.

Network NOVA continues to grow and evolve in response to the changing dynamics of politics in the Commonwealth. They are unabashedly progressive women leaders who understand we have to center our conversations with fellow Virginians around shared values. They are committed to supporting the leadership aspirations of women who step forward to run for office while also building a network of trained volunteers to help those candidates win.
